Pot Light Installation Questions
What are pot lights? Pot lights are recessed lighting fixtures installed into ceilings to provide a clean, streamlined illumination option for indoor spaces.
Where can pot lights be installed? They can be placed in living rooms, kitchens, hallways, or any area where even, unobtrusive lighting is desired.
Are there different types of pot lights? Yes, options include adjustable, dimmable, and energy-efficient models to suit various lighting needs and preferences.
What should property owners consider before installation? It’s important to assess ceiling height, existing wiring, and the desired lighting effect to ensure proper placement and performance.
